Output 31de4dadb8d14a1e9ca222ac7a11fba3624e209920bcf2a0dc5d622d0469d5bd:0

value
17909094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81b17901086ece1109950fc0a0aeff3ad4adbbed OP_EQUALVERIFY OP_CHECKSIG
address
1CpkmmHbJa7oQpQngBYSaKVxxyX8D51Qbq
transaction
31de4dadb8d14a1e9ca222ac7a11fba3624e209920bcf2a0dc5d622d0469d5bd
spent
true